# Keyboardmania - Keyboard **Keyboardmania** is a rhythm video game developed and published by Konami. It was released for the PlayStation 2 on **September 21, 2000**. Plug the Keyboardmania - Keyboard into a USB port. 2. Open the PCSX2 via RetroDECK Configurator. 3. **Configure USB Ports** - Go to `Config` -> `Controllers (PAD)` -> `Plugin Settings`. - In the `PAD` settings window, select `USB` from the tabs at the top. - Assign the Keyboardmania - Keyboard to `USB Port 1`. 4. **Map the Keys** - In the `USB` settings, you will see a list of keys that need to be mapped. - Click on each key and press the corresponding key on the Keyboardmania - Keyboard to map it. - Ensure all keys are mapped correctly. 6. **Save and Apply Settings** - Once all keys are mapped, click `OK` to save the settings. - Exit PCSX2 to RetroDECK and start Keyboardmania.
